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7031881 74425060 404056 0630016
9299209819 52511914437
9299209819 52511914437
95370452 3221540452 5111980 20801809
All about undefined
Interested in learning more?
9299209819 52511914437
95370452 3221540452 5111980 20801809
See more
15957 0234 812538
674840 640 165673927
See more
79808851 47888184705
80938402 078060923 5506381
See more